How to Power a Project Webb18 juli 2012 · The ground plane connects all the ground pins on a PCB automatically, which usually makes routing easier. It can also reduce electrical noise on the board. WebbIn the event that it is not possible, for reasons of space or budget, to create entire ground planes, use a single point (low frequencies) or star (high frequencies) grounding, connecting all the ground traces at the common ground point. USE THE GROUND PLANE: This technique is popular among designers and one of the effective ways to establish grounding in your PCB boards. It refers to a large plane of copper that carries a return current from different points in PCB. Unlike a perfboard or stripboard, breadboards do not require soldering or destruction of tracks and are hence reusable. For this reason, breadboards are also popular with students and in technological education. if yes how
